Through these haunting and evocative stories, Chekhov invites us to explore the boundaries of belief, fear, and human connection. In the title story, a woman's mysterious powers captivate and unsettle those around her, creating a vivid portrait of the power of superstition and the unknown. The other tales in this collection continue this exploration, revealing the fragile line between what we see and what we feel, between the rational and the inexplicable, Chekhov's storytelling is as atmospheric as it is precise, weaving a spell of wonder and melancholy that lingers long after the final page.
